I was talking with Donna ( meangirlmakeup.blogspot.com ), and she thought MAC's Parisian Skies would be a good color for Kelsey (who is blonde with blue eyes) and would go well with her colors (blue green and purple). This is a swatch I took from Temptalia of MAC's Parisian Skies

I found a pretty close color from Essence 

Blue Moon by Essence


The middle swatch was with Urban Decay's Greed Primer. Not a bad dupe for a $3 shadow! 
But it definitely needs a primer.

KISS SALON FRENCH NAILS

I picked these up at the Dollar General for $2.50. I grabbed a couple because I've been wanting to get my nails done professionally, but up here it's too expensive. And my friend is getting married in a week and I'm her maid of honor so I can't have my normal trashed nails. 

AMAZINGLY these have held up for 4 days. Usually when I wear fake nails, they fall off the next day if not sooner, but this is them on day 4.
And everyone keeps asking me where I got them done! I'm really impressed and wish I'd grabbed like 6 packs. At the local stores, fake nails are three times what I paid for these in New York.

FUNKY FINGERS CRACKLE

I picked this up a store I'd never heard of before - 5 Lo. I really wanted to get a crackle polish, but the Chinese Glaze formula seems really hard to use, and I wasn't that in love with it so I didn't want to plop the $7 for it. This crackle was only $1.50. And the formula is just thin enough that you don't have to really worry about putting too much on and having the crackle not crack.
That's the Funky Fingers black Crackle over Sinful Colors Gorgeous. LOVE IT.
